#556328 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#556328 is composed of 33.3% red, 38.8%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.6%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 74.2 degrees, a saturation of 42.4% and a lightness of 27.3%. #556328 color hex could be obtained by blending #aac650 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#556328 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#556328 has RGB values of R:85, G:99,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 5595944.

Shades and Tints of #556328
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#f8faf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#556328
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474843 is the less saturated color, while #698803 is the most saturated one.
